AD Alcorcón

AD Alcorcón FC is a Spanish football club based in Alcorcón, in the autonomous community of Madrid. They currently compete in the Segunda Federación, the fourth tier of the Spanish football league system. The club was founded on July 20, 1971, and plays its home games at the Estadio Municipal de Santo Domingo with a capacity of approximately 5,100 spectators.
